Skip to content

Активност

Осветљена рибарска мрежа

Почетник | MakeCode, Python | Звук, Лед екран, Сензор светла | 14 Живот испод воде, Одабир, Улаз/излаз

Корак 1: Уради

Шта је ово?

Користите свој micro:bit за стварање прототипа од лед диода која могу спречити рибе, корњаче и птице да буду ухваћене у рибарској мрежи.

Овај пројекат део је серије направљене како би се понудиле активности за решавање проблема и дизајнирању прототипова за истраживање технологије као решења за изазове Глобалних циљева одрживог развоја.

Увод

Водич за програмирање

Шта сте научили

  • Како направити прототип за већи пројекат
  • Како рачунари прихватају очитавања са улаза, обрађују податке да би направили различите излазе у зависности од вредности улазних података

Како то функционише

  • Прототип је радни модел који се користи за тестирање идеја. Не заборавите да micro:bit држите подаље од воде!
  • Овај програм користи micro:bit лед диоде као сензор светлости. Казује micro:bit-у да укључи лед диоде када је светлост мања од одређеног нивоа (50).
  • Покријте micro:bit лед екран како би сте симулирали таму дубине мора и он би требало да се укључи.
  • Можда ћете морати да промените број 50 у зависности од услова осветљења у просторији у којој се налазите. Ако се превише лако упали, користите мањи број.
  • Ако имате прикључен звучник или користите нови micro:bit са звуком, он емитује високофреквентни импулсни звук који помаже да друга бића држе даље од мрежа.

Шта вам је потребно

  • micro:bit (или симулатор у MakeCode)
  • MakeCode или Python уређивач
  • батерије (опционално)
  • додатак за звучник или нови micro:bit са звуком (опционално)

Корак 2: Програмирај

1from microbit import *
2import music
3
4while True:
5    if display.read_light_level() < 50:
6        display.show(Image(
7        "99999:"
8        "99999:"
9        "99999:"
10        "99999:"
11        "99999"))
12        music.play("A5")
13    else:
14        display.clear()
15    sleep(1000)

Корак 3: Унапреди

  • Промените лед фаблон у анимацији пулсирајућег светла
  • Створите сопствени звук да бисте уплашили свесна бића која не желите да ухватите
  • Додајте радио-везу за даљинско управљање светлима и звуком